In the studio with Nils Frahm
"For his new album All Melody, Nils Frahm transformed Saal 3 at the former East German broadcast centre Funkhaus in Berlin into an analogue recording studio to match the scope of his ideas. We visited Frahm in the studio to find out about the making of the album and how this unique space has helped shape his sound."
